Education: The Science of Smell Containment

Understanding how diaper pails tackle odor is key to making the right choice. Most effective diaper pails work on two main principles: sealing the odor in and minimizing air exchange. Materials play a crucial role – metal is generally superior to plastic for odor containment as it doesn't absorb smells. The seal between the lid and the pail is another critical factor. Some systems create a tight seal, while others rely on a continuous bag system that theoretically seals each diaper individually.

The 'no special bag' approach, like Ubbi's, often relies on a robust metal construction and a good seal, allowing you to use any standard trash bag. This offers flexibility and can save money in the long run. On the other hand, systems like Janibell's use a continuous liner system, where you tie off the bag yourself after each deposit. This method aims for maximum odor isolation for each diaper, potentially offering superior sealing power, but at the cost of proprietary refills.
